Harris County Astrodome Construction

In February, the Harris County Commissioners Court approved moving forward with a $105 million project to turn the Astrodome in Houston, Texas into a revenue-generating event and convention space. According to the Houston Business Journal, plans for the project include raising the Astrodome floor 30 feet to ground level, which would create more than 500,000 square feet of rentable space. Additionally, the renovation would create 1,400 parking spaces and nearly 8 acres of space that could be used for outdoor events. The economic benefits from a project of this scope will be seen through not only revenue from events, but also will come in the form of newly created jobs.

The newly released timeline says engineers and officials plan to commence construction immediately following the 2019 Houston Rodeo.
